The interest among young people of Bulgarian origin from abroad in studying at Bulgarian higher education institutions is growing. Among those who have enrolled for the upcoming academic year, the largest number are those from Ukraine, Moldova, North Macedonia and Serbia.
A decree of the Council of Ministers provides preferential conditions for such an opportunity for our compatriots from the diaspora without Bulgarian citizenship.
Bulgaria's Ministry of Education and Science provides 2,000 places for Bulgarians from abroad, with students exempted from tuition fees, receiving subsidies for dormitories and scholarships. The most preferred majors remain medicine, economy and architecture. The application process has been simplified and is conducted entirely online.
The Ministry of Education continues to work actively to attract the Bulgarian diaspora through information campaigns and meetings.
